The New DNA: Patent & Premium

The 2026 return of the 6-inch boot isn't about subtle changes; it’s about a total visual overhaul. The brand is playing with the "Classic" formula by injecting high-gloss finishes and aggressive hardware.

Liquid Patent Leather: The star of the season. Timberland has introduced a high-shine patent execution that gives the 6-inch silhouette a futuristic, reflective edge. It’s the classic "Wheat" and "Black" colorways, but with a mirror-like finish that demands attention.

The "Holographic" Collar: Moving beyond basic padded leather, the new iterations feature iridescent and metallic collars. These small, high-contrast details provide a sharp, modern pop against the traditional nubuck or patent uppers.

Aggressive Monochrome: We’re seeing a shift toward "total-look" boots. From the hexagonal eyelets to the heavy-duty laces and the rugged lug outsoles, every component is color-matched to create a seamless, monochromatic power-piece.

Remastered Proportions: The 2026 models feature a slightly sharper toe box and an amplified midsole height. It’s a subtle play on the classic "Construct" shape that makes the boot feel leaner and more tailored for a modern streetwear fit.

Timberland has mastered the art of the "re-issue." By keeping the "street-king" foundation: the quad-stitch detail and the indestructible lug sole, while swapping out the traditional engine for high-gloss patent leather, they’ve created a boot that feels entirely new.
